Output 19369021dc8c4016fd8b32acc46d8207d7d21969b4bc44aa17d31e55510ee75c:1

value
530601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b038b2ce4d837285877e433d63fd27f0fcf10d2 OP_EQUAL
address
3QaFmumQoJCnYxP8R1rWZd3qiu7W9HYsKi
transaction
19369021dc8c4016fd8b32acc46d8207d7d21969b4bc44aa17d31e55510ee75c
spent
true